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0544 07676069295 7194 254816508 243717
598232 077 7578338
598232 077 7578338
251027125 212073 29319537139
All about undefined
Interested in learning more?
598232 077 7578338
251027125 212073 29319537139
See more
6670058 016 2189946
630 1181 839490950 83503815
See more
316193769 76401235569 31
39 28 71 535678770
See more